Tree pruning is an vital practice for maintaining tree health, security, and visual appeal. Appropriate pruning eliminates dead, infected, or structurally weak branches, lowering the risk of breakage and improving air blood circulation and sunlight exposure. This procedure supports healthy growth, enhances blooming or fruiting, and can even correct structural concerns in young trees. Pruning methods vary depending upon the types, size, and desired outcome. Crown thinning, crown raising, and crown reduction are common approaches that balance growth with safety and appearance. Using sharp, clean tools and making cuts at proper angles decreases stress and motivates healing. Routine tree pruning likewise adds to landscape security, avoiding branches from hindering structures, power lines, or pedestrian locations. Seasonal pruning schedules ensure that trees stay healthy and visually appealing without jeopardizing their natural form
